Title: View of the Cascades at Saint-Cloud by Louis-Pierre Baltard, Paris, 1803 : This finely executed original antique copperplate engraving depicts the celebrated Cascades of the Château de Saint-Cloud, one of the most admired water features in France during the late eighteenth and early nineteenth centuries. The composition presents the magnificent terraced fountains in full operation, framed by perfectly clipped avenues of trees and animated by elegantly dressed visitors enjoying the royal gardens. The Château de Saint-Cloud was among the grandest royal residences of France, serving successive Bourbon monarchs before becoming a favored palace of Napoleon Bonaparte. Its celebrated cascades, ornamental fountains, and formal gardens were masterpieces of French landscape architecture and attracted visitors from across Europe until the palace was destroyed during the Franco-Prussian War in 1870. The engraving was created by the distinguished French architect and engraver Louis-Pierre Baltard (1764–1846) and published in Paris in 1803 as part of the celebrated Napoleonic-era publication Paris et ses Monuments, mesurés, dessinés et gravés. This monumental work documented France's most important architectural monuments and gardens through meticulously engraved copperplates of exceptional artistic and architectural quality.
